With a laser tube-cutting machine, there are no standard towers. Bundle loads are the most efficient method for handling tubes. These loaders feed one tube per bundle into the tube cutter via a singularizing mechanism. This feeding method is not compatible with open profiles such as angles or channels. Because they interlock within a bundle, and don't allow for easy release, this type of feeding doesn't work. Step loaders are employed for open profiles. These machines sequence one section at a time and maintain the correct orientation.

Because of the amount of power required to create a CO2 laser, it is less efficient and has a much lower wall plug efficiency when compared to a fiber laser. It follows that the large chillers required for the CO2 lasers need more overall power too. Given the fiber laser resonator’s wall plug efficiency of more than 40 percent, you are not only using less power, but also less of your in-high-demand floor space.

You may have noticed that we haven’t discussed cutting speed yet. It is possible to cut up to 500 inches per minute on a tube, but that’s not always realistic. In laser tube cutting, the real focus should be on how long it takes to load a tube, index it so it’s in the right position for cutting, pierce and cut it, and unload the part. It’s more about part-processing time with laser tube cutting machines, not cutting speed.
